Definition
Renunciation is the formal act of rejecting or giving up a claim, right, belief, or possession, often for moral or spiritual reasons.
Usage & Nuances
"Renunciation" is formal and most often used in legal, religious, or philosophical contexts. Common phrases: 'renunciation of citizenship', 'renunciation of worldly goods'. Not everyday speech; use 'give up' or 'quit' in casual contexts.
